Designing output-feedback predictive controllers by reverse engineering existing {LTI} controllers

Hartley E.N. and Maciejowski J.M.

(Accepted for publication in IEEE Transactions on Automatic Control), 2013
DOI: 10.1109/TAC.2013.2258781

Abstract

An approach to designing a constrained output-feedback predictive controller that has the same small-signal properties as a pre-existing output-feedback linear time invariant controller is proposed. Systematic guidelines are proposed to select an appropriate (non-unique) realisation of the resulting state observer. A method is proposed to transform a class of offset-free reference tracking controllers into the combination of an observer, steady-state target calculator and predictive controller. The procedure is demonstrated with a numerical example.
